Course structure

• Understanding Suicide in Marginalized Communities
• Cultural Considerations in Suicide Prevention
• Intersectionality and Suicide Risk Factors
• Trauma-Informed Care for Suicide Prevention
• Building Resilience in Marginalized Populations
• Access to Mental Health Services for Marginalized Communities
• Advocacy and Policy Development for Suicide Prevention
• Community Engagement Strategies for Suicide Prevention
• Addressing Stigma and Discrimination in Suicide Prevention
• Self-Care and Burnout Prevention for Suicide Prevention Professionals
